WebbTo get the total days, hours, and minutes between a set of start and end dates, you can adapt the formula using SUMPRODUCT like this: = INT ( SUMPRODUCT ( ends - starts)) & " days " & TEXT ( SUMPRODUCT ( ends - starts),"h"" hrs ""m"" mins """) where "ends" represents the range of end dates, and "starts" represents the range of start dates.
